DEVICE FOR MANUALLY COMPACTING WASTE
The invention relates to a device for manually compacting waste contained in a container, including a frame having a support plate that is intended to be positioned and/or fastened to the ground, and two lateral uprights, a left-hand lateral upright and a right-hand lateral upright, respectively, that are secured to the support plate and extend perpendicularly thereto, with the support plate and the lateral uprights delimiting a central space that is able to receive a container containing waste. The device also includes two manually actuable levers, namely a left-hand lever fastened to the left-hand lateral upright so as to pivot about a left-hand pivot axis and a right-hand lever fastened to the right-hand lateral upright so as to pivot about a right-hand pivot axis, with the left-hand and right-hand pivot axes being parallel and defining a plane parallel to a plane defined by the support plate. The device further includes at least one push bar, at the lower end of which a compression plate is fastened, with the push bar being connected to the left-hand lever and/or the right-hand lever by way of at least one connecting member that is able to slide along the left-hand lever and/or right-hand lever and which is configured to act on the push bar under the action of the left-hand lever and/or right-hand lever so as to move it towards the ground or away from the ground, thus making it possible to move the compression plate towards or away from the support plate from an equilibrium position in which it rests on the waste to be compacted.
Manually Operated Trash Compactor for Airplane Lavatory and Method for Compacting Trash
An example lavatory waste compartment includes a waste bin having a waste compartment for trash, a waste flap providing an opening into the waste compartment for insertion of the trash, and a manually operated trash compactor coupled to a ceiling. The manually operated trash compactor includes an expansion component connected to a compacting head, and a retraction component coupled to the expansion component to hold or retract the expansion component to a stowed position. An increase in temperature above a threshold temperature causes the retraction component to release the expansion component resulting in deployment of the compacting head into the waste bin. An actuation device is provided to deploy the expansion component from the stowed position, and when deployed, the expansion component blocks opening of the waste flap, and the retraction component causes the expansion component to retract to the stowed position via release of the actuation device.
Trolley for collecting waste
A trolley for collecting waste includes: wheels, a steering handle, and a housing with a bottomwall and a sidewall extending vertically from the bottomwall, wherein the housing forms a waste chamber, wherein the sidewall comprises an opening, wherein a flap is connected by a first bearing to the sidewall of the housing, such that the flap is pivotable about a horizontal flap axis between a closing position and an opening position. The flap in its closing position closes the opening of the sidewall, and the flap in its opening position opens the opening in the sidewall, wherein the handle is connected by a second bearing to the housing, such that the handle is pivotable about a handle axis between a first handle position and a second handle position, and the handle is linked to the flap by a mechanical linkage, such that pivoting the handle from its second handle position to its first handle position results in a pivoting of the flap from its opening position to its closing position.

APPARATUS FOR FORMING BLOCKS OF COMPACTABLE MATERIAL
Apparatuses for forming blocks of compactable material such as snow, having a hollow upper body with a compression chamber within for containing and subsequently compressing the compactable material to form a block that can be used in connection with recreational activities. A lower body having a flat compression plate attached to a top end, is configured to slide within the compression chamber, the compression plate being capable of pushing the compactable material into a hinged lid that is attached to a top end of the upper body and acts to cover a top opening of the upper body. Ferromagnetic materials attached to the underside of the compression plate are configured to contact other ferromagnetic materials attached to the interior walls of the compression chamber, which at least temporarily arrests sliding movement of the upper and lower bodies, and allows a user to fill the apparatus with compactable material.
Trash compactor
A trash compactor includes an enclosure assembly, a press assembly, and a lever assembly. The enclosure assembly includes a tray and an enclosure extending from the bottom end of the tray. Furthermore, the press assembly includes a press member disposed within the enclosure. The press member includes openings that receive rods therethrough. The rods being secured to opposing interior walls of the enclosure allowing the press member to slidably traverse an interior portion of the enclosure. A lever is then engaged with the actuating rod that is configured to be actuated by a user to compact trash placed within the enclosure.

Trash compactor systems and methods
A trash compactor system includes a receptacle defining a retaining chamber that is configured to receive and retain trash, a compaction plate moveably secured within the retaining chamber, and a foot pedal operatively coupled to the compaction plate. Engagement of the foot pedal moves the compaction plate within the retaining chamber to compact the trash retained within the retaining chamber. A flap may cover an opening into the retaining chamber. The foot pedal may also be operatively coupled to the flap, such that the engagement of the foot pedal moves the flap into an open position that exposes the opening.
